American parents have registered 2,241 Almetas since 1880, against 881 Almers. Neither name reached five babies in 2025.

Each line is every baby given the name that year, girls and boys added together — the only count that means the same thing for both names. A line breaks where the name fell below five babies in a year — the point at which the SSA stops publishing it — rather than being drawn through a figure nobody published. A single published year in a gap shows as a dot.

Who was ahead

Of the 94 years in which either name was published, Almeta for 87 years and Almer for 7 years. The lead changed hands 7 times.

A rank is a position within one sex’s list for one year, so the two rank rows are not subtracted from one another and the winning column is not marked on them. The living figure is a life-table estimate, not a count.

Which name is older

Half of the Almers alive today are over 80; half the Almetas are over 72. That is 8 years between them: two names in use at the same time, worn by two different generations.
